Occident, Volume C [3], Number 1, Spring 1980







Thomas Parkinson contributes "William S. Burroughs: Critical Approaches", a talk given at the M.L.A. Convention, Chicago, 1977, pp. 15-18.

Published in Berkeley, CA. at the University of California in Spring of 1980.
